Virginia democrats express shock over Fairfax murder suicide

The killing, described by police as a domestic violence incident linked to an ongoing divorce, has drawn attention from lawmakers to the prevalence of such cases and the need for support resources.

Indian American Democrats from Virginia expressed shock after a murder-suicide involving former lieutenant governor Justin Fairfax.

According to authorities, Justin fatally shot Cerina Fairfax before taking his own life at their home in Annandale on April 16, in what authorities described as a domestic incident linked to an ongoing divorce.

U.S. Rep. Suhas Subramanyam (VA-10) said Cerina Fairfax “was a kind, wonderful woman who was beloved by those who knew her,” adding he was “shocked by this horrible act of violence.” He extended condolences to her children and family.

Subramanyam also highlighted the broader issue of domestic violence, stating it remains “far too common in our society” and urging those at risk to seek help through the National Domestic Violence Hotline.

 



Current Virginia Lieutenant Governor Ghazala Hashmi, in a statement said, “Virginia woke up this morning to the devastating news regarding Dr. Cerina Fairfax and former Lieutenant Governor Justin Fairfax. My thoughts are with their children, loved ones, and numerous friends. Along with so many in the Commonwealth, I am filled with sorrow; I await further insights from our law enforcement officials.”



Virginia State Senator Kannan Srinivasan described the development as “extremely heartbreaking and horrific,” adding that his thoughts and prayers are with Fairfax’s children and loved ones.



Police said the couple’s two teenage children were present in the home at the time, and one of them called 911, officials said.

Authorities indicated the violence may have been connected to a “messy divorce” and recent legal developments in the case, with Fairfax having been served court documents ahead of a scheduled hearing.

Cerina Fairfax was a practicing dentist, and the couple had been married for nearly two decades before separating but continuing to live in the same residence.

Justin Fairfax was once considered a rising Democratic figure before his career was derailed by past controversies.
